Answer:

proteins: build(s) and maintain(s) tissue

water: help(s) cleanse the body of toxins

fats: store(s) calories for future use

vitamins: facilitate(s) normal growth and function; organic compound

carbohydrates: provide(s) a major source of energy for the body

An injury in which a nail is partly or completely torn loose is known as A nail Avulsion

<h3>Meaning of Nail Avulsion</h3>

Avulsion can be defined as a condition where a body part is taken off by force either through surgery or an accident that causes pain.

Nail Avulsion can be defined as the removal of a nail from its nail bed either by force or by surgical operations.

In conclusion, An injury in which a nail is partly or completely torn loose is known as A nail Avulsion
